Terms of Endearment is a 1983 American family comedy-drama film directed, written, and produced by James L. Brooks, adapted from Larry McMurtry's 1975 novel of the same name. It stars Debra Winger , Shirley MacLaine , Jack Nicholson , Danny DeVito , Jeff Daniels , and John Lithgow .
